Choosing the Right Fabrics for the Australian Climate

Selecting the perfect tiered maxi dress australia is as much about the thermometer as it is about the mirror. Our climate demands more from our clothing than just aesthetic appeal. We need garments that breathe, move, and withstand the intensity of a Southern Hemisphere summer. It's the difference between feeling fresh at a 3:00 PM garden party or feeling trapped in your own outfit.

Cotton and linen remain the undisputed gold standard for Australian conditions. These fibres are naturally porous, allowing heat to escape your body rather than trapping it against your skin. This functional approach to style is a long-standing tradition in our local industry. If you look at the exhibition of 200 Years of Australian Fashion, you'll see how our designers have historically prioritised natural resources to combat the heat. These materials don't just look premium; they perform when you need them most.

While cotton provides structure, rayon and viscose are the secret to that coveted "swish" as you walk. These plant-based fibres offer a silk-like drape that allows tiers to cascade beautifully without adding bulk. Fabric weight determines whether a tier stands out or hangs elegantly. A heavy linen might feel substantial and premium, but a lightweight viscose will move with a romantic, fluid grace. Be wary of "sweat traps" often found in mass-market options. A dress might be 100% cotton on the outside, but if it's lined with cheap polyester, you'll lose all the cooling benefits. Always check the labels for cotton or viscose linings to ensure true comfort.

Natural Fibres vs. Synthetic Blends

100% cotton is the ultimate choice for those with skin sensitivity. It's soft, hypoallergenic, and actually gets better with every wash. However, high-quality blends, such as linen-viscose, are often preferred for their wrinkle resistance. These blends maintain the cooling properties of linen while reducing the heavy "crinkle" factor. You can spot premium designer-inspired quality by the subtle sheen of the weave and a cool-to-the-touch feel that synthetic polyesters simply can't replicate.

Understanding Drape and Volume

The fabric you choose dictates the final silhouette of your tiered dress. Stiff fabrics like cotton poplin create a dramatic, architectural look where the tiers hold their shape and create a bold, voluminous statement. This is perfect for making an impact at formal events. Conversely, soft fabrics like voile or silk create a romantic, slimming silhouette that skims the body rather than standing away from it. Matching your fabric choice to your desired level of "poof" is the key to mastering this trend. Flattering Every Figure: How to Style Tiers Without the Bulk

Many women worry that the volume of a tiered maxi dress australia will result in a shapeless "tent" look. This is a common misconception that often prevents stylish women from embracing one of the most comfortable silhouettes available. In reality, well-designed tiers can actually elongate your frame by creating a rhythmic verticality. By understanding the history of the maxi dress, we see how designers have used these horizontal seams to play with proportion for decades. The secret lies in the placement of the tiers and how you balance that volume with other elements of your outfit.

Tier placement is the most critical factor in achieving a polished look. A high-waisted first tier creates the illusion of longer legs, while transitions starting at the hip provide a more relaxed, bohemian feel. To maintain a streamlined look, you should look for "graduated tiers" where the volume increases subtly toward the hem rather than all at once. Balancing the lower volume with the right neckline is equally important. A deep V-neck draws the eye inward and upward, effectively counteracting the width of the skirt. Conversely, a high neck can create a more dramatic, avant-garde silhouette that works beautifully for formal events.

Defining the Waist in a Tiered Design

You don't have to lose your shape to enjoy a flowing dress. Adding a slim leather belt is a simple way to break up the volume and define your waistline instantly. Alternatively, look for designs with smocked bodices. This feature provides a snug, comfortable fit through the torso before releasing into the tiers, creating a beautiful hourglass shape. For more tips on choosing the right cut for your body type, check out our guide on dresses for every occasion. It's about finding the balance between the fabric's movement and your natural curves.

Proportions and Tier Placement

Your height shouldn't dictate whether you wear tiers, but it should influence how you style them. Smaller adjustments can make a significant difference in how the garment sits on your frame.

  • Petite Frames: Stick to subtle tiers and monochromatic colours. This prevents the dress from "chopping" your height and maintains a continuous vertical line that adds the illusion of stature.
  • Taller Frames: You have the freedom to embrace bold, contrasting tiers and extra length. Don't be afraid of maximalist volume; your height can easily support the extra fabric.
  • Footwear Impact: A block heel or wedge adds the necessary height to support the weight of the fabric, while flat leather slides lean into a grounded, coastal aesthetic perfect for casual weekends.

The right combination of accessories and footwear ensures your tiered maxi dress australia looks intentional and perfectly proportioned. When you choose pieces with a supportive fit and thoughtful seam placement, the "tent" fear disappears, replaced by a sense of grace and confidence.

How do I wash and care for a tiered maxi dress to keep its shape?

Preserve the structural integrity of your dress by opting for a cold hand wash or a gentle machine cycle in a mesh bag. Always use a mild detergent to protect the delicate fibres of the tiers. Avoid the tumble dryer at all costs; instead, air dry the garment on a padded hanger to maintain its shape and prevent stretching. A quick steam once dry will restore the perfect "swish" and volume to each layer.

How do I stop a tiered dress from looking too puffy?

Control the volume by selecting dresses made from soft, fluid fabrics like rayon or cotton voile that skim the body. These materials drape elegantly rather than standing away from the frame like stiffer poplins. You can also define your waist with a slim belt or choose a design with a smocked bodice to create a more streamlined silhouette. This approach ensures the tiers add movement and interest without creating an unwanted or bulky effect.
